To commemorate the 60th anniversary of the Hong Kong Public Libraries in 2022, the Libraries organised the 32nd Chinese Poetry Writing Competition to promote Chinese language proficiency and public appreciation of traditional verse.

This year’s Ci composition category required participants to compose to the tune pattern “Die Lian Hua”. The judging panel consisted of Professor Ho Man‑Wui, Professor Nicholas Louis Chan, Professor Huang Kunyao, and Professor Lau Wai-Lam.

The competition received over 500 submissions, with impressive entries in both the Student and Open Sections. After rounds of primary and secondary selection and extensive deliberation, the judges determined the awardees. To ensure fairness, all submissions were reviewed anonymously.

For the Student Section, shortlisted participants were invited to meet the adjudicators in person and compose couplets on the spot as an additional assessment to determine the final award results.
